Providing a welcome addition to the community, Owners Michael Knowles and Kathy Huynh Knowles, Larchmont Village residents since 2012, opened the doors of Knowles Karate Academy officially on June 1st. Within a week and a half, they already had 30 enthusiastic students signed up. Following a refreshing transformation, the corner space, which is now the studio at 3rd and Manhattan, is light, airy and bright. Students have ample space to practice on the cushioned mats, and can check to ensure proper form is being achieved, in the large mirrors.Together with their son Logan, who recently celebrated his fourth birthday at the studio, Michael and Kathy have happily opened a new chapter – both within the community, and within their own lives.

Hailing from Southern New Jersey, Michael has trained in Martial Arts since 1990. He obtained his third degree blackbelt in April 2012, and became a Certified Instructor of Soo Bahk Do Moo Duk Kwan in April 2016. In between, Michael has been a member of Team USA’s Roller Hockey team, an accomplished actor, writer, director, producer, cinematographer, and acting/writing coach. After moving to Los Angeles in 2008, Michael also invented a Camera Support and Stabilization System, known as Atlas Camera Support – an invention he and his wife Kathy patented, and have been successfully selling worldwide. Michael and Kathy also have a film production company (dragonbabyproductions), named after their son, Logan.

Kathy was born in Saigon. She escaped with her family, as a young girl in the late 1970’s – fleeing Communist rule in Vietnam. She resettled in Canada, and later completed her university studies in Toronto, graduating with a Bachelor’s Degree in Fashion. She worked at Club Monaco, and was eventually transferred to New York City. During her 18 years in the Fashion Industry, Kathy became the youngest senior executive at a Fortune 500 company. She eventually decided to leave the business behind to pursue a different path, translating her ability to manage and lead, into helping people learn and grow – and motivating them to achieve their best with Knowles Karate Academy.
